How to Reach Gisenyi in Rwanda

Gisenyi, also known as Rubavu, is a beautiful city located in the western part of Rwanda. Situated on the shores of Lake Kivu, it offers stunning views and a serene environment. If you are planning a visit to Gisenyi, here are some ways to reach this peaceful destination:

By Air:

For international travelers, the most convenient way to reach Gisenyi is by flying into Kigali International Airport, which is the main gateway to Rwanda. From there, you can take a domestic flight to Kamembe Airport in Cyangugu, which is approximately a 3-hour drive from Gisenyi. Several airlines operate domestic flights within Rwanda, providing easy access to the city.

By Road:

If you prefer a road trip, you can reach Gisenyi by bus or private car. From Kigali, you can take a bus from the Nyabugogo Bus Park to Gisenyi. The journey takes around 3-4 hours, depending on the traffic and road conditions. Alternatively, you can hire a taxi or rent a car to enjoy a more flexible and comfortable journey. The road to Gisenyi offers picturesque landscapes, so make sure to have your camera ready!

By Boat:

Another unique way to reach Gisenyi is by taking a boat ride across Lake Kivu. If you are coming from Bukavu in the Democratic Republic of Congo, you can board a boat that connects the two cities. The boat journey offers a scenic experience as you cruise along the lake, surrounded by lush green hills. It is advisable to check the boat schedules in advance, as they may vary depending on the season and weather conditions.

Getting to know Gisenyi

Gisenyi is a picturesque city located in the Western Province of Rwanda. Situated on the shores of Lake Kivu, Gisenyi offers breathtaking views of the surrounding mountains and the shimmering lake. With its stunning natural beauty and pleasant climate, Gisenyi is a popular destination for both locals and tourists.

One of the main attractions of Gisenyi is its beautiful beaches along Lake Kivu. The sandy shores provide the perfect spot for sunbathing, swimming, and various water activities. Visitors can also take a boat ride on the lake to explore the nearby islands or enjoy fishing in its abundant waters. The clear blue waters of Lake Kivu are incredibly inviting and offer a refreshing escape from the city's hustle and bustle.

Gisenyi is also known for its vibrant and bustling local markets. The city is a hub of trade and commerce, where visitors can find a wide array of fresh produce, local handicrafts, and traditional Rwandan textiles. Exploring the markets is a great way to immerse oneself in the local culture and witness the daily lives of the friendly and welcoming Rwandan people.
